Today, the national mythological epic "Fengshen Part II: War in Xiqi" directed by director Wuershan officially started pre-sales. The historical accumulation and cultural imagination complement each other, and this mythological epic world full of traditional Chinese cultural elements undoubtedly adds a unique New Year's flavor to the first "Intangible Cultural Heritage Edition Spring Festival" in 2025.

The film released a preview of the "Why We Fight" version, in which Shang King Yin Shou (played by Fei Xiang) dispatched a large army of Yin Shang soldiers including Deng Chanyu (played by Na Er Na Qian), Grand Tutor Wen Zhong (played by Wu Xingguo), and the four generals of the Mo family to conquer Xiqi in order to seize the title of Fengshen. Faced with the invasion of the Yin and Shang armies, the ancient city of Xiqi, which had not experienced war for hundreds of years, was on high alert. The military and civilians dressed in plain clothes and linen mobilized the entire city's strength, led by Jiang Ziya (played by Huang Bo) and Ji Fa (played by Yu Shi), to defend their homeland in a fierce battle. In this war, some people fight to the death to defend their homeland, some sacrifice their lives for their mission, and some resort to any means necessary for their ambitions... The film will show how people will overcome magic in a battle of disparate strength. Whether it's the sword and sword shadows on the cliff, the galloping horses, the raging war in front of the city gate, guarding the gate to the death, or the perilous scenes within the canyon, each scene exudes a magnificent and epic mythological aura.
